Patranque (Bread and Bacon Pancake from France)

Prep Time: 15 Minutes
Cook Time: 30 Minutes
Ready In: 45 Minutes
Servings: 4

Ingredients:
500 g stale brown bread
85 g bacon
1 medium garlic clove (finely chopped)
250 g mozzarella cheese (french tomme de cantal cheese suggested)
Directions:
1. Remove the crusts from the bread & crumble coarsely. If the bread is very stale, it may be softened w/a sml amt of water. Slice cheese thinly. Set the bread & cheese aside.
2. Cut the bacon into very sml pieces & cook in a non-stick frying pan over mod-heat till they are completely transparent & begin to crisp.
3. Add bread to the pan & stir about to soak up the fat from the bacon & break up more.
4. Add garlic. When it begins to brown, add cheese slices & stir well.
5. Reduce heat, add salt & pepper to taste & allow to brown for about 10 minutes.
6. When a crust has formed, turn pancake using a spatula & a plate so the other side can brown for 5-10 minutes.
7. Slide pancake onto a plate, divide in 4 portions & serve immediately.
8. SERVING SUGGESTION: Just a green salad was suggested, but I see mushrooms sauteed in garlic as another good choice to accompany this dish w/the salad.
